Insurance

As electricians are professionals there are a lot of risks that electricians face. However they can protect themselves from financial losses by purchasing the right insurance. This insurance can help electricians keep their businesses running smoothly in the event of an injury or accident. It also lets them comply with a wide variety of rules and regulations.

General liability: This covers expenses that are related to personal injury or property damage, bodily injury and advertising errors in addition to other common accidents. You can purchase liability insurance as a standalone policy, or as part of a policy for business owners (BOP).

Workers compensation: Employers must have workers' compensation insurance to safeguard their employees in the event that they get hurt while working for them. It covers medical bills along with lost wages, as well as a death benefit in the event of the employee's death.

Commercial auto: Most states require that companies carry commercial auto insurance if they have company vehicles. It is a way to cover the medical expenses of your employees or vehicle damage as well as injury claims in the event of an employee being involved in a car crash while driving your company truck.

Errors and omissions: Every business should also have an error find A electrician near me and errors and omissions (E&O) policy to protect against lawsuits that result from unsatisfactory work. These policies can be costly, but they will protect your company in the case of a lawsuit that involves an error that could have led to an individual losing money.

Specialization

Electricians install and repair wiring and other electrical components found in homes, businesses and other structures. They are often required to travel on both indoor and outdoor projects.

According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), electrician jobs are predicted to grow by 8% between 2019 and 2029. They earn higher than the median wage for all occupations and electricians who specialize in alternative power sources , or solar energy generally have higher earnings.

They can also Find A Electrician Near Me jobs on air and maritime vessels, oil rigs, or in hospital and research areas. The specific knowledge and security requirements of these jobs are attractive to employers.

Typically, they require the high school diploma or GED certificate to be able to enter the field. Some students opt to enroll in an associate degree or certificate program while others opt for an apprenticeship.

Many programs prepare students for licensure. This involves passing a set of state exams and on-the-job-training. To stay current on the latest safety regulations and building codes, they have to take a range of continuing education courses.
